Transaction 37363803a2dc36091bedabc221c9423700d2a3667408268c7f9c4a4a54cac243
1 Input
1 Output
-
37363803a2dc36091bedabc221c9423700d2a3667408268c7f9c4a4a54cac243:0
- value
- 24355310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ab090c9d0433099060f0e20b6f5624c815930a7f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GbMPZKyfPJKNPXrDzouPtWoi4PMLhj2gH